How much do part time web developer jobs pay per hour?

As of May 29,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time web developer in Texas is $42.04,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$32.26 and $50.82 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Part Time Web Developer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Part Time Web Developer, you need proficiency in HTML, CSS, JavaScript, and a solid understanding of responsive web design, often complemented by a degree or relevant coursework in computer science or web development. Familiarity with version control systems like Git, content management systems such as WordPress, and front-end frameworks like React or Angular is typically required. Strong time management,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ills set exceptional candidates apart. These competencies enable web developers to deliver high-quality solutions efficiently while collaborating with clients or teams on a flexible schedule.

What does a part time web developer do?

A part time web developer is responsible for designing, building, and maintaining websites or web applications on a reduced or flexible work schedule. Their tasks often include writing code, updating website content, troubleshooting technical issues, and collaborating with other team members such as designers or project managers. They may work for a company, agency, or as a freelancer, and their hours are typically less than a standard full-time position. Part time web developers often work remotely and may handle multiple projects for different clients. This role is ideal for individuals seeking flexibility or balancing other commitments.

Nature & Purpose of Position
Provides design, development, testing, maintenance, and oversight of departmental websites/ intranet sites and other similar web-based media to ensure optimal performance and availability.
This is a part-time, hourly, temporary, non-benefits eligible position, working 19 hours or less per week, expected to end on or before 08/31/2026. Specific hours and workdays to be determined. 
Primary Responsibilities
Works with staff to identify, deliver, develop, test, and maintain web pages and other media for the Institute for Homeland Security (IHS). Performs cross browser development and testing. Documents processes. Receives and responds to incoming communications regarding web and other media needs by IHS. Ensures Americans with Disability Act (ADA) compatibility for websites and related media. Performs other related duties as assigned.
